Fly fishing is quickly becoming the most popular excursion within Costa Rica because of the incredibly large variety of species which can be caught through this exhilarating form of fishing. Every avid angler wants the opportunity to catch a Marlin at one time or another and Costa Rica offers a wide variety of Marlin that can be caught throughout many different areas of the country and contrary to what you may think, catching a Marlin is not that unheard of. Many tourists return home from their Costa Rican adventure with pictures and fishing stories of their fight with the famous Marlin.
Quepos is one of the most highly recommended coastal towns on the Pacific side of Costa Rica when it comes to fly fishing for Marlin. Blue and Black Marlin are the most common, however once in awhile a striped Marlin is caught and released because of its rarity. Offshore fly fishing is the absolute best way to catch Marlin and anytime during the months from December to May. The high season for this type of extreme sport fishing is from January through to March and if fly fishing is your choice of excursion during your stay it is always beneficial to book ahead because locals often take advantage of this new popular sporting event as well. Combine kayaking and fishing and you have a fun, tropical adventure within the boundaries of beautiful Costa Rica. Although kayaking is great exercise, you do not have to be in impeccable shape to take advantage of this amazing fishing excursion. You will be amazed just how much ground you can cover in a short amount of time, distracted by the beautiful scenery that only Costa Rica can offer. During your journey from shore out to the sea, you are trolling with deep sea fishing lures and using your own muscles and power to troll the line.
